Anchorage Travels to Wisconsin to Play Windigo

Dec 13, 2022

Anchorage, Alaska | 12/13/22 | Isaac Smoldon

After securing three out of a possible four points this past weekend against the Kenai River Brown Bears, the Anchorage Wolverines travel to Eagle River Wisconsin for their last two games before the 2022-23 regular season’s Christmas break. Fedya Nikolayenya was a key performer for Anchorage during the weekend, scoring three goals and two assists, enough to earn him “star of the week” for the Midwest division.

The Wolverines will be looking for some revenge on this trip, due to Wisconsin winning two of the three games the two teams played against each other in Anchorage a month-and-a-half ago. Both teams have been in the process of recovering from a slow start to the season, and both have been playing much better as of late, with Wisconsin only losing three of their last 10, and the Wolverines looking to continue a five game point streak. Only seven points separate the 1st place team in the Midwest, the Minnesota Wilderness, and 6th place Anchorage. With that in mind, a weekend sweep has the ability to propel the Wolverines into a playoff position before Christmas break, depending on the results of the Fairbanks/Janesville, and Kenai River/Chippewa games this weekend.
